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
334940 7388 024
68509 9289
68509 9289
42 07108 0154
All about undefined
Interested in learning more?
68509 9289
42 07108 0154
See more
021832905 73397 0347370
444922 984 55144219675 2360231041
See more
374 33
5474 31481070 38481
See more